Tagovailoa returns to training after two concussions

Tua Tagovailoa, quarterback of the Miami Dolphins, returned to training this Wednesday after suffering serious concussions in weeks 3 and 4 of the NFL, the professional American football league, but will not be lined up by his coach, Mike McDaniel, in Sunday’s game against the Minnesota Vikings, corresponding to the sixth day.

“I don’t see him inside yet. I can say with certainty that he is not going to play this week,” McDaniel said.

The quarterback (game organizer) for the Dolphins he suffered his first concussion on September 25, in a Week 3 matchup with the Buffalo Bills, late in the second quarter. He left the field after suffering a blow to the back of the head, but was still cleared by the NFL to return for the second half of the game.

On Thursday, September 29, without any medical restrictions, Tagovailoa started the game against the Cincinnati Bengals and suffered another concussion, as a result of which he was taken to the hospital.although he was discharged the same day.

Since then, he has complained of severe headaches that made his stay under medical observation urgent, within the concussion protocol.

Last Sunday, in the fifth week game that Miami lost to the New York Jets, Teddy Bridgewater took his place on the pitch.

Unfortunately, Bridgewater also suffered a concussion, from a blow to the head he received on a playhad to leave the game and will also not be available to play Sunday against the Vikings.

Bridgewater will be replaced by rookie Skylar Thompson.selected in the seventh round of the draft this year, who will make his first NFL start against Minnesota.

With Tagovailoa as starter, his team linked three victories. His absence has resulted in two defeats.
